Jorge E. Hirsch, a condensed-matter physicist at UC San Diego whose own
research is in superconductivity theory rather than bibliometrics, proposed the
*h-index* in 2005 in a paper titled "An index to quantify an individual's
scientific research output" (*PNAS* 102(46):16569–16572). The index is a single
number: a researcher has index *h* if *h* of their papers have each been cited
at least *h* times. Its appeal was compactness — it folds productivity (paper
count) and impact (citations) into one figure that can rank people.

The h-index is the most consequential *individual-level* descendant of the
citation-counting paradigm that Eugene Garfield's Institute for Scientific
Information industrialized (see
[[claim-garfields-isi-became-private-equity-owned-clarivate]]). That lineage is
the tension the vault's bibliometrics cluster keeps circling: Garfield built
journal-level metrics and
[[claim-garfield-warned-impact-factor-unfit-to-judge-individuals|repeatedly warned they were unfit for judging individuals]],
yet the h-index does exactly that — reduce a person to a citation number. It
therefore sits squarely in the target zone that
[[claim-dora-2013-declaration-rejects-impact-factor-for-research-assessment|DORA (2013)]]
later told institutions to abandon, and it is as gameable as the journal
metrics behind
[[claim-wilhite-fong-2012-coercive-self-citation-common]] and
[[claim-saudi-universities-bought-clarivate-highly-cited-researcher-status]]:
self-citation cartels and fabricated author identities can inflate an h-index
directly. The recurring shape is Goodhart's Law — a measure built to describe
influence becomes an evaluative target and stops measuring what it once did.
